Pharmaceutical Biotechnology Products in the Form of Hand Washing Soap Kombucha Bunga Telang (Clitoria ternatea L) as Antibacterial for Salmonella thypi and Listeria monocytogenes

Abstrak

The growth of Salmonella thypi and Listeria monocytogenes bacteria can be inhibited by butterfly pea flower kombucha. This is because telang flower kombucha has pharmacological activity so it can be developed in the pharmaceutical field. This research needs to be carried out to make hand washing soap made from an active solution of telang kombucha diffusing solution so that it can stop the growth of Salmonella thypi and Listeria monocytogenes bacteria. The research method uses laboratory experiments. The data obtained were then analyzed using One Way Analysis of Variance and post hoc. The results of the study showed that the formulation and preparation of hand washing soap with a concentration of 40% active ingredient in a solution of butterfly pea flower was able to stop the growth of both bacteria with a P value <0.05. In conclusion, these two bacteria can be inhibited with hand washing soap containing 40% of a decoction of butterfly pea flower kombucha.
